# How do you calculate average in PL SQL?

## How do you calculate average in PL SQL?

SELECT AVG(salary) AS “Avg Salary” FROM employees WHERE salary > 25000; In this AVG function example, we’ve aliased the AVG(salary) expression as “Avg Salary”. As a result, “Avg Salary” will display as the field name when the result set is returned.

**How do you find the average in Oracle SQL?**

The Oracle AVG() function accepts a list of values and returns the average. The AVG() function can accept a clause which is either DISTINCT or ALL . The DISTINCT clause instructs the function to ignore the duplicate values while the ALL clause causes the function to consider all the duplicate values.

**What is the function of AVG () function?**

AVG is an aggregate function that evaluates the average of an expression over a set of rows (see Aggregates (set functions)). AVG is allowed only on expressions that evaluate to numeric data types.

### What is the syntax for AVG?

Description. Returns the average (arithmetic mean) of the arguments. For example, if the range A1:A20 contains numbers, the formula =AVERAGE(A1:A20) returns the average of those numbers.

**Does AVG count NULL values SQL?**

SQL Average function and NULL values AVG() function does not consider the NULL values during its calculation.

**Where should Avg be used in SQL?**

SQL AVG function is used to find out the average of a field in various records. You can take average of various records set using GROUP BY clause. Following example will take average all the records related to a single person and you will have average typed pages by every person.

#### How do you calculate averages on a calculator?

How to Calculate Average. The average of a set of numbers is simply the sum of the numbers divided by the total number of values in the set. For example, suppose we want the average of 24 , 55 , 17 , 87 and 100 . Simply find the sum of the numbers: 24 + 55 + 17 + 87 + 100 = 283 and divide by 5 to get 56.6 .

**What is Avg function in Oracle/PLSQL?**

Description. The Oracle/PLSQL AVG function returns the average value of an expression.

**What is oror the syntax for the AVG function?**

OR the syntax for the AVG function when grouping the results by one or more columns is: Expressions that are not encapsulated within the AVG function and must be included in the GROUP BY clause at the end of the SQL statement. This is the column or expression that will be averaged.

## How to get the average value of a set in SQL?

Summary: this tutorial, we will show you how to use SQL AVG function to get the average value of a set. The SQL AVG function is an aggregate function that calculates the average value of a set. The following illustrates the syntax of the SQL AVG function:

**How to use Avg in SQL with a subquery?**

SQL AVG with a subquery. We can apply AVG function multiple times in a single SQL statement to calculate the average value of a set of average values. For example, we can use the AVG function to calculate the average salary of employees in each department, and apply the AVG function one more time to calculate the average salary of departments.